Download SampleThe Saudi Arabia rigid plastic packaging market is characterized by a diverse array of material types, each contributing uniquely to the sector's dynamic landscape. Leading the charge is Polyethylene Terephthalate (PET), prized for its recyclability and robust barrier properties that make it ideal for preserving the quality of food and beverages. Following PET, polyethylene (PE) is highly valued for its flexibility and chemical resistance, making it suitable for a wide range of applications. Polypropylene (PP) stands out for its durability and high melting point, which are essential for packaging products that require sterilization. Polystyrene (PS) is preferred for its rigidity and clarity, often used in packaging items that benefit from a clear display, like food containers and disposable cups. Polyvinyl Chloride (PVC), despite its environmental concerns, continues to be used due to its versatility and cost-effectiveness in applications where durability is key. The Saudi Arabia rigid Plastic Packaging market is characterized by a sophisticated and innovative production process segment, reflecting the industry's commitment to quality and efficiency. The production process begins with the procurement of raw materials, primarily polymers like PET, PE, PP, PS, and PVC, sourced from both domestic and international suppliers. These materials undergo extrusion, where they are melted and formed into continuous shapes, such as sheets or films, which are then cut into desired sizes. Injection molding is another critical process, used to create intricate shapes and designs for bottles, jars, and closures, ensuring precision and consistency. Blow molding produces hollow objects like bottles and containers by expanding the molten polymer into the mold cavity with air pressure. Thermoforming creates trays and blister packs by heating a plastic sheet until pliable and shaping it using a mold. Stretch blow molding, a specialized technique, manufactures high-strength PET bottles by combining extrusion and blow molding. Advanced decorating techniques like printing, labeling, and hot stamping enhance the aesthetic appeal and functionality of the packaging. Quality control measures are rigorously implemented at every stage to meet stringent standards and regulatory requirements. The Saudi Arabia Rigid Plastic Packaging market is vibrant and multifaceted, with its application type segment reflecting the diversity of industries it serves. The food and beverage sector stands out as the largest consumer, utilizing rigid plastic packaging for its unparalleled ability to preserve freshness, extend shelf life, and provide tamper-evident solutions. This includes everything from milk jugs and water bottles to yogurt cups and juice containers. In the healthcare and pharmaceutical industry, rigid plastic packaging is critical for ensuring product safety and integrity, with applications ranging from sterile blister packs for pills to robust containers for medical supplies. The cosmetics and personal care sector also relies heavily on rigid plastic packaging, favoring the durability and aesthetic appeal of materials like PET and PP for products like shampoo bottles, lotion dispensers, and makeup cases. The household products market uses rigid plastic packaging for items such as cleaning agents and detergents, where the material's resistance to chemicals and ability to prevent leaks is invaluable. In the industrial sector, rigid plastic packaging is employed for bulk storage and transportation of chemicals and lubricants, thanks to its strength and stability.
